Certified Management Accountant (CMA)

Certified Management Accountant (CMA) is a national certification held by many corporate managers and controllers. Our bachelor’s in accounting fulfills educational requirements. Certification also requires accounting experience and a passing score on the exam. Detailed information is available at www.Imanet.org.

Certified Internal Auditor (CIA)

A certified internal auditor (CIA) examines and evaluates a company’s financial and information systems, management procedures and internal controls for evidence of fraud and to ensure regulatory compliance. Our bachelor’s in accounting fulfills educational requirements for the CIA. More information is available from the Institute of Internal Auditors at www.theiia.org.

Accredited Business Accountant/Advisor (ABA)

The Accreditation Council for Accountancy and Taxation (ACAT) offers the Accredited Business Accountant/Advisor certification (ABA). The ABA requires three years of experience and a passing grade on the ABA exam.

Enrolled Agent (EA) certification. An enrolled agent focuses on tax services for individuals and small businesses. An EA may be self-employed, work for the IRS or work for an accounting firm. Only EAs, CPAs and attorneys may represent taxpayers before the IRS. This accounting certification is regulated by the U.S. Internal Revenue Service (I.R.S.).
